I. Classification of singular shapes of industrial robots
The singularities of industrial robots refers to an industrial robot Jacobian matrix rank reduction geometric located. For industrial robots with six degrees of freedom, the singularity of the Jacobian matrix is ​​irreversible. Roughly speaking, the singular shape of industrial robots can be divided into two categories:
(1) The singular shape of the boundary of the working space of the industrial robot;
(2) The singular shape inside the workspace, usually caused by the coincidence of two or more joint axes. The two joint angles provide the end motion at an infinite speed, in which the industrial robot loses one degree of freedom, making the end motion difficult to achieve. It is precisely the initial position of the articulated industrial robot, that is, the joint type industrial robot at the initial position has a singular solution, and there is a singular phenomenon. To avoid the singular shape, the fourth and sixth joints of the industrial robot are given a constant angular velocity.
